What does the in-line filter contribute to the overall functionality of a hydraulic system?

The in-line filter plays a crucial role in maintaining the health and efficiency of a hydraulic system by filtering hydraulic fluid before it is used. Hydraulic systems rely on clean fluid to operate effectively; contaminants such as dirt, metal shavings, or other particles can cause significant damage to pump components, valves, and actuators. By removing these impurities, the in-line filter ensures that the hydraulic components are protected, which prolongs their lifespan and enhances the overall reliability and performance of the system.

Maintaining cleanliness in hydraulic fluid is essential for minimizing wear and tear on the moving parts, reducing the likelihood of system failures, and ensuring consistent operation throughout the life of the equipment. This filtration helps to maintain optimal flow rates and pressure, making the hydraulic system perform at its best.
